Ugx. 86,789,410
View detail
Ugx. 98,841,344
Ugx. 98,523,480
Ugx. 77,438,304
Ugx. 81,524,560
Ugx. 95,204,056
Ugx. 87,563,010
Ugx. 85,178,850
Ugx. 82,164,504
Ugx. 97,512,230
Ugx. 79,574,760
Ugx. 90,286,870